Analysis
The most recent figure for number of maternal deaths in Ecuador is 149.67, measured in 2023. That is the lowest value across all 39 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 20.8% on the previous year and down 29.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, number of maternal deaths in Ecuador peaked at 566.65 in 1985 and was at its lowest, 149.67, in 2023.
That places Ecuador 74th out of 194 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 39 years of available data.
